Commercial Lot Clearing in Atlanta, GA
Commercial lot clearing services involve the removal of trees, shrubs, debris, and other obstructions to prepare land for development, construction, or landscaping projects. This process typically includes land grading, stump removal, brush clearing, and debris hauling to create a clean, level, and accessible property. Property owners often request this service when planning new construction, parking lots, or outdoor facilities, ensuring the land is ready for its intended use and meets local regulations.
Before requesting commercial lot clearing, property owners should consider factors such as the size of the area, types of vegetation or obstacles present, and any permits or regulations that might apply to the project. It’s also helpful to understand the scope of clearing required and any potential impact on surrounding areas.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and aligns with the specific needs of the property.

Commercial Lot Clearing Questions
What types of commercial lots can be cleared? The service can handle a variety of lots, including vacant land, construction sites, and properties with overgrown vegetation, preparing them for development or sale.
What equipment is used for lot cl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and skid steers are commonly used to efficiently remove trees, brush, and debris from the site.
Is debris removal included in lot clearing? Yes, clearing services typically include the removal and disposal of trees, brush, stumps, and other debris left after the clearing process.
What should property owners consider before clearing a lot? It’s important to assess the lot’s terrain, access points, and any local regulations or permits needed for the clearing project.
